是的,您可以使用Graph API将组事件“添加到我的日历”。Graph API是微软提供的一组开发工具和服务,用于与Microsoft 365中的数据进行交互。通过Graph API,您可以访问和操作用户、组织、邮件、日历、联系人、任务等各种数据。
要将组事件添加到您的日历,您可以使用Graph API中的Calendar API。首先,您需要获取访问令牌(access token),以便进行身份验证和授权。然后,您可以使用POST请求向指定的日历添加事件。
以下是一个示例请求:
POST /me/calendars/{calendarId}/events
Content-Type: application/json
Authorization: Bearer {access_token}
{
"subject": "组事件标题",
"start": {
"dateTime": "2022-01-01T09:00:00",
"timeZone": "Pacific Standard Time"
},
"end": {
"dateTime": "2022-01-01T10:00:00",
"timeZone": "Pacific Standard Time"
},
"body": {
"contentType": "HTML",
"content": "组事件描述"
},
"attendees": [
{
"emailAddress": {
"address": "attendee1@example.com",
"name": "参与者1"
},
"type": "required"
},
{
"emailAddress": {
"address": "attendee2@example.com",
"name": "参与者2"
},
"type": "optional"
}
]
}
在上面的示例中,您需要替换{calendarId}
为目标日历的ID,{access_token}
为您获取的有效访问令牌。您还可以根据需要设置事件的其他属性,如开始时间、结束时间、描述、参与者等。
推荐的腾讯云相关产品:腾讯云API网关。腾讯云API网关是一种全托管的API服务,可帮助您轻松构建、发布、维护、监控和安全地扩展API。您可以使用腾讯云API网关来管理和保护您的Graph API,并提供高可用性和性能。
更多关于腾讯云API网关的信息,请访问:腾讯云API网关产品介绍
领取专属 10元无门槛券
手把手带您无忧上云